Happy 123sDay Trackable

To help you celebrate this New Year’s Eve and its doubly cool date – 12/31/23, NoVAGO and MGS are pursuing a joint fundraiser for area cachers. The two groups are working with Oakcoins/GeoSwag to produce three customized versions of the World Wide Group Project Happy 123sDay trackable (https://geoswag.com/product/123123-world-wide-group-project/). The MGS version will feature colors from the Maryland state flag. In the NoVAGO version, the trackable will highlight the blues and greens of the great Virginia outdoors. There will also be an American version featuring red, white and blue. These fundraisers will only be available through MGS and NoVAGO. You can purchase one trackable for $15, two trackables for $25 or three trackables for $35. Your trackables will be delivered during NoVAGO and MGS caching events on New Year’s Eve. 2023 NoVAGO Fall Picnic

On Sunday, October 22, 2023, NoVAGO held its annual Fall Picnic. The event was held in Lorton on the new Laurel Hill Central Green. Prior to the event there was a CITO event, also on the Central Green. During the event, several geocaches published around the park. There was also a silent auction which took place during the event. This year’s NoVAGO board is a high functioning team and while all the members contributed advice the following were there in person to make the 2023 NoVAGO Fall event as success! TrexM8s compared locations and found one big enough for our group. She worked with the park managers to make the event a success, including getting permission for the CITO and the caches hidden in the park. In addition, she helped organize the silent auction. Don’t be afraid to reach out to a cache owner.

When and how to reach out to a CO and how it benefits the greater geocaching community.  Many years ago when I was training as an engineer, it was commonplace to see technical drawings stamped ‘If In Doubt Ask!‘. Most seasoned cachers believe in this adage and will message Cache Owners (CO’s) for advice and guidance when stuck on a puzzle or at a particularly evil cache hide. CO’s are usually very willing to provide a “nudge” and it isn’t uncommon for them to be so eager to help that they will jump in their car and race out to meet a cacher in distress! To contact the CO, go to the top of the caching page for that GC number and click “message this owner”.
